On Mon, 24 Nov 1997, [ISO-8859-1] Jorge M. Véliz M. wrote:
> the protocols, in SCO UNIX the serial port is tty1a and you just open it
> and read from it or write to it, but I don't know how to do it in FreeBSD,
> please help me...

Exactly the same way.  tty1a on SCO is ttyd0 on FreeBSD
